Reconstructed baryon transition current structure (N(1535) negative parity F1 form factor) via selective flattening: Insights from Patterson function analysis
This study refines the reconstruction of the Dirac‑type transition current density of the N(1535) negative parity F1 resonance through selective flattening. The analysis reveals a compact positive core with a half‑maximum radius of 0.0339 fm, encircled by a diffuse negative shell. These features emphasize the highly localized spatial structure of the N(1535) resonance and provide direct empirical imaging of baryonic substructure.
